To your question, the effect is simply a mask which reveals the text on a layer below and has a burning edge added via a second layer. This would be easy to do in a Rotoscoping software package or a newer version of Photoshop (CS3 and higher can generate video files). It should also be possible with Motion.
Create the mask movement by progressively applying black to a white image.
Reimport a copy of the mask. Adding blur to the edge of the white part will give you a soft edge which can be color mapped -this uses the differing shades of gray and replaces them with the fire colors. Composite the burning edge clip over your text, using the mask in Travel Matte Luma mode.

    Very simple stuff. You just can't do it with one layer.
    Set up you text with each statement on a separate layer, then simply animate the position of the text. You can set up that animation with the transformation properties or with text animators. There's information on both methods in the help files.

  • Shape Layer to 3D Text Effect

    Hey guys,
    I'm trying to figure out if there is a way that I can create a shape layer to and give it the 3D text effect.  To further explain, I created some text in Photoshop, but for it to be stylized, I did it with the pen tool so my words are shape layers instead of text layers.  Im also using CS6 normal and not extended, so I don't have that 3D option at the top.  If there is a method for this, I would greatly appreciate the help.  Thank you!
    Examples of what I'm going for:
    http://maxcdn.photoshoplady.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/Clean-3D-Text-Effect-Creation-u sing-CS6-L.png
    http://vanimg.s3.amazonaws.com/0613-text-15.jpg

    I didn't look at your example until after I made the demo image, but you could work it to produce that effect.
    What we used to make 3D text before we had Photoshop 3D tools, was Free Transform Step & Repeat.  You'll find a bunch of tutorials if you look, but basically:
    Make your front shape, make a copy and rasterize the copy. Hide the Shape because you don't need it any more.
    Copy your rasterized shape layer.
    Free Transform the copy, and use the size and movement values in the options bar.  For my demo I moved it up a couple of pixels, and resized to 98% horizontally and vertically.
    Hold down Shift Alt Ctrl (Shift Opt Cmd) and keep hitting the t key until you have sufficient depth.  You end up with a lot of layers.  My size and movement was a bit course, which you can see from the jaggies on the bottom left of the '3' character.
    Select all the 3D layers, and go Layers > Arrange > reverse (you just want to bring your initial layer to the top of the stack.
    Select all the other 3D layers and merge them
    Give the initial layer a different colour or tone.
    You'll want to add some shading, so make a new layer above the merged layers, Ctrl click the merged layers to load the selection, and add a layer mask to the new layer (called shading in my image)
    Unlink the layer mask.  This is so we can blur our shading without bleeding past the text boundries.
    I prefer to paint in the shading because you can blur and adjust opacity.  Paint it in with a hard brush for accuracy, and use a LOT of blur (Gaussian 10)
    You might need multiple layers and selections to control the different faces, but I just finished off with the Dodge tool.
    Having the front face and body on different layers, means you can mess about with layer styles, or colorize with a hue/saturation layer.
    A bit more dodge and burn with some careful masking and perhaps a curves layer set to luminosity...  You have the building blocks and can keep adding to them.
